New ABC Comedy: Ruth Bader Ginsburg in Teen's 'Masturbation Nook'
ABC debuted Splitting Up Together March 27 with the pilot episode and the premise is that a couple is divorcing and yet still sharing their house, for financial reasons. Every other week one gets custody of their three children while the parent without custody that week stays in the garage. That was the least of the unusual twists for this show.

‘Roseanne’ Reboot: Thanking God for Making America Great Again
It’s been twenty years since the last Roseanne episode and on March 27 ABC debuted the reboot with a double episode. The original cast is back and the live audience’s laughter is much better than canned laughter. The main storyline is the Conner family working together to find common ground and support each other, like families everywhere.
